At a glance
Ohio Third Frontier Technology Validation & Start-Up Fund is a Ohio state competitive grant from Ohio Third Frontier Commission (OTF) providing up to $150,000 for validating and licensing technologies from ohio research institutions. Eligible applicants are ohio universities, colleges and nonprofit research institutions (phase 1); ohio startups licensing institutional technology (phase 2). The application deadline is August 27, 2026. Apply via development.ohio.gov.

About this program
TVSF Phase 1 funds Ohio institutions to validate commercially promising technologies; Phase 2 funds startups that license those technologies to reach market milestones. The program bridges the gap between lab results and license-ready IP, with two review rounds annually.
Who can apply
Ohio universities, colleges and nonprofit research institutions (Phase 1); Ohio startups licensing institutional technology (Phase 2).
How to apply
Applications are submitted through the Ohio Third Frontier Commission online portal. Register your organization, complete the online application form, and upload a project narrative, budget and supporting documentation before the deadline. Late or incomplete submissions are not reviewed.
